Stocks

Super Micro Computer (NASDAQ:SMCI) Shares Down 0.5% - Should You Sell?

Published January 17, 2025

Super Micro Computer, Inc. (NASDAQ:SMCI) experienced a slight decline of 0.5% in its share price during afternoon trading on Tuesday. The stock reached a low of $30.90 and was last seen trading at $30.91. A total of 9,064,365 shares changed hands, marking a significant drop of 70% compared to the average trading volume of 30,684,318 shares. The stock had closed at $31.08 in the previous session.

Wall Street Analysts Forecast Growth

Recent evaluations from various research analysts have painted an interesting picture for Super Micro Computer. Northland Capital Markets recently upgraded the stock to a "strong-buy" rating in a report published on December 20. In contrast, Barclays has lowered its price target for Super Micro to $42.00 from $438.00 and has given it an "equal weight" rating as reported on October 2. Meanwhile, Goldman Sachs adjusted its price target from $67.50 to $28.00 and issued a "neutral" rating in a note on November 6. Argus also downgraded the stocks from "buy" to "hold" on October 31. Loop Capital reduced their target price significantly from $150.00 to $100.00 while maintaining a "buy" rating in a report released on September 23. As it stands, three analysts rate the stock as a sell, eleven suggest holding, four have issued buy ratings, and one analyst has given a strong buy rating. According to MarketBeat, the consensus rating is "Hold" with an average target price of $66.89.

Understanding Super Micro Computer's Financials

The company operates with a market capitalization of $17.41 billion and has a price-to-earnings ratio of 15.62, accompanied by a beta value of 1.31. Its 50-day and 200-day simple moving averages stand at $32.35 and $47.41 respectively. On the liquidity front, Super Micro has a quick ratio of 1.93 and a current ratio of 3.77, indicating a solid short-term financial position. The debt-to-equity ratio is at 0.32, suggesting prudent leverage management.

Institutional Investor Activity

Recent activity from institutional investors indicates growing interest in Super Micro Computer. Prairiewood Capital LLC entered a new stake valued at $457,000 in the fourth quarter. Diversify Advisory Services LLC invested around $5,113,000 in new shares during the same period. Additionally, Annex Advisory Services LLC made a notable purchase worth approximately $6,708,000 in the fourth quarter. Lbmc Investment Advisors LLC also acquired shares valued at about $344,000, and Trust Co. of Vermont expanded its position significantly by 900.0%, accumulating 1,000 shares currently valued at approximately $30,000. Notably, institutional investors hold around 84.06% of the stock, reflecting significant confidence in the company's prospects.

Company Overview

Super Micro Computer, Inc. specializes in the development and manufacturing of high-performance server and storage solutions based on modular and open architecture. The company operates globally, providing a diverse array of products including complete server systems, storage solutions, modular blade servers, workstations, networking devices, server sub-systems, and management software, among others.

Final Thoughts

As investors consider their positions, it's essential to note that while Super Micro Computer currently holds a consensus "Hold" rating among analysts, MarketBeat highlights five other stocks that were recommended as more favorable buys. Investors should weigh this information carefully before making decisions regarding the stock.

stocks, analysis, finance